These are the axles that come on most tricycles and quad cycles. They’re all pretty much the same. And I figured out the last project how they work. They’re a solid axle, but the issue is they’re onehe drive. Now, this side is completely attached to the axle, so that’s locked to the gear set. This side is on a bearing, so it spins. What that allows you to do is when you go around a corner, these tires move at different speeds and sometimes different directions if you’re pivoting. Now, if you want to put a decent amount of power through something like this, it’s just going to violently torque steer to one side. You see the front wheel move? Whoa. This thing ain’t safe. I don’t know whether to point out to you guys cuz I am going to be doing an X1 Pro crazy 6000 watt. Let’s just talk about fitment why I’m not putting this on it. And there’s another reason why as well. First reason is I’m not going to take this all to bits now. But like this won’t go through again. This would have to be at that angle. I can make this fit. I would have to remove this controller. And I don’t know how long the cables are to relocate it. I imagine they’re pretty short. You can see the cables in there. Like you would have to remove you would have to remove the controller for one to get this into there cuz it’ll be I can see that’s going to be hitting that part of the frame. And second reason, there is absolutely no point doing it on this. It’s got a seven-speed freewheel, so you can’t use a cassette. You can’t use the HD cassette. Obviously, these are welded up, so you can’t just change out cassettes and sprockets all the time. 6,000 W of mid drive, 285 Nm of torque will annihilate most gear sets. It’s freewheel, it’s not cassettes, you can’t get anything like really substantial. Alternatives are going up to motorbike sprockets, but then you lose the gearing and you’d probably need to get a thicker axle. I thought about this and as much as I like doing crazy, um I don’t like doing a lot of work for nothing. It might like I could get that X1 working with a flipping lot of work, but it will last about 20 30 seconds. And can I be bothered? Hell no. Let’s go. It’s really easy to work on. However, one little thing was suddenly the back brake, which was the only brake I was using, the power just suddenly went in it. And it was really bizarre cuz there was no fluid leaked anywhere. Now, I’ve had a little look into it and I figured out what’s happened. So, we’ve got no front brakes and we’re putting all the pressure on the back and I was squeezing it really hard to try and make it skid. So, what’s happened is I thought the brake was broken, but this axle has this axle’s got these little black lock collars so you can fit attachments on it. And on the other side of this black lock collar is one of them. Now, that’s got a thread in it, and it it screws up probably anticlockwise the opposite way. And then you’ve got the six holes for the brake disc. But what’s happened is, or what I can presume’s happened, I’ve squeezed it so hard it’s got to the end of the thread. And look, it’s actually killed the uh the brake so powerful, it’s actually crossthreaded it. I can’t remember if it goes that way to tighten up, but now it won’t tighten. It gets a bit tighter and the thread’s just gone. So the lock collar is probably steel and these are probably soft aluminum. So that’s buggered and we can’t change it because I’ve welded the axle.
